This is a hinged, spring loaded clip that fits in a square hole, and holds a coin. I use these to hold down the edges of warped panels on my buildlog.net laser 2.x laser cutter bed, which is a grid of half inch squares, a half inch deep. But I expect you'll find other uses for this. Lots of square holes out there. The SCAD file lets you configure the square size and depth, coin size, and how high the coin is held above the surface. Typically the hinge is fused on the bottom layer after printing. Just gently squeeze the top and bottom of the clip alternately to crack it free.
